Types of Containment Systems
There are three main types of pet contaiment systems available in the market,
and their selection depends on the type and size of the pet.
Indoor containment systems which are used for keeping generally small-sized pets
inside the house or within set indoor boundaries. These systems allow you to
restrict or expand the limits of movement of your pets in the room or rooms of
your choice. The doors usually have a small trap door that is quite popular.
They are very convenient for the pet and the owner, who doesn't need to open the
door for the pet anymore.
Outdoor containment systems are sometimes invisible or wired fencing around the
property or any specific area to permit or prohibit the access of your pet. For
instance, these can specifically be attached to your dog's kennel so you won’t
need to tie the dog to the kennel to keep him contained.
The third type of system is the wireless pet containment system, which works
with the help of a transmitter. This pet containment system works by delivering
small amounts of static electricity to the dog whenever this one tries to go out
of the established boundaries. Eventually, the dog figures out that it can avoid
the shocks by not leaving the assigned area.
